Hello, I am really noob... could you tell me why you need the transistor? It works even without just current does not flow when there is no water... Where am I wrong? Thank you very much...
bartoszkola621
7 years ago
You've just mistook the base and connector (the middle and top pins). Also you should incrrease the resistance of your sensors or decrease the resistance of your power supply.
LeButch
7 years ago
The noob is totally right: the transistor has no purpose.
bartoszkola621
7 years ago
You need a transistor to control a high current circuit using low current. In this situation transistor is useless because theres nothing to control. If u put a DC motor (water pump) instead of resistor with high resistance then you will need a transistor.
